Abstract

Gender studies in the province of Manabí-Ecuador, are almost nonexistent and scarcely raised in the social and political arenas of the region. Consequently, the discussion, which is limited in itself, falls on speeches and practices encrypted in sexist structures, reproducing messages about their social representations in that province. Therefore, the symbols and speeches are analyzed to know that reality, from the perspective of a group of inhabitants directly and indirectly connected as the context. A qualitative methodology is applied with ethnographic tools based on interviews and image analysis. The symbolic representations show us stereotypes and internalized roles in unequal and violent practices, in a population strongly embraced by the cultural identity of their people, in which the masculine power over the feminine is naturalized.
